Understanding Order Ready Notification Laws in Georgia
In Georgia, like many states, Order Ready Notification Laws govern how businesses communicate with customers about their order status. These laws are designed to protect consumers from unwanted autodialer calls and texts, ensuring that such communications are made only with explicit consent. For Griffin Dry Cleaners, understanding these regulations is crucial to avoiding legal pitfalls and maintaining customer satisfaction. Businesses must obtain prior authorization before using an autodialer to notify customers that their orders are ready for pickup.
